Skills, Responsibilities & Benefits
Key skills and qualifications: Pharmaceutical Care, Medication Therapy Optimization, Pharmacy Operations, Team Collaboration, Patient Care, Cost-Effective Care. Candidates with experience in these areas may be especially well-suited for this Pharmacy role.
Core responsibilities: The Clinical Pharmacist is responsible for providing high-quality, individualized, and cost-effective pharmaceutical care and integrated pharmacy operational services. This role involves collaborating with the healthcare team to optimize patient medication therapy outcomes and quality of life.
Benefits package: Comprehensive benefits package, Retirement 401(k) Savings Plan with employer matching, Health care benefits (medical, dental, vision), Life insurance, Disability insurance, Paid parental leave, Vacations, Holidays.
